HTMLDocument の拡張機能 HTML5 は、DOM レベル 2 HTML の一部の HTMLDocument インターフェイスを拡張します。これらのインターフェイスは、Document インターフェイスを実装するすべての要素オブジェクトに実装されます。 HTML5 には、いくつかの新しいメンバーも追加されました。 getElementsByClassName(): クラス クラスを使用して要素を取得します。このメソッドは、クラス属性とクラス パラメーターに一致する値を持つ要素と Document オブジェクトをクエリするために使用できます (例: SVG およびMathML )。 innerHTML: HTML/XML ドキュメントを解析およびシリアル化する方法。このプロパティは、以前のバージョンのブラウザでは HTMLElement のみをサポートしていましたが、現在は HTMLDocument をサポートしていません。 activeElement と hasFocus: どの要素が現在のフォーカス要素であるか、および Document に独自のフォーカスがあるかどうかを宣言します。 HTMLElement の拡張機能は HTML5 であり、いくつかの拡張機能が HTMLElement インターフェースに追加されました:
1. HTML5 学習ノート簡潔バージョン (11): 新しい API
はじめに: HTML5 DOM レベル 2 HTML は、一部の HTMLDocument インターフェイスを拡張します。これらのインターフェイスは、Document インターフェイスを実装するすべての要素オブジェクトに実装されます。 HTML5 にはいくつかの新しいメンバーも追加されました:
2. HTML5 学習ノートの簡潔なバージョン (10): 廃止された要素と属性
はじめに: このセクションにリストされています。 HTML5 で使用されており、既存のドキュメントが HTML5 にアップグレードされた場合に使用できる代替手段がいくつかあります。たとえば、パーサー セクションは isindex 要素の機能を処理できます。
3. HTML5 学習メモの簡潔版 (9): 変更された要素と属性
はじめに: HTML5 での以下の要素の使用法は、 web の使用はより大きな役割を果たす可能性があります:
4. HTML5 学習ノートの簡潔なバージョン (8): 新しいグローバル属性
はじめに: いずれかの要素が contenteditable 属性を使用する場合、それは次のことを表します。この要素は編集可能な領域です。ユーザーは要素の内容とアクション タグを変更できます。例:
5. HTML5 学習ノートの簡潔なバージョン (7): 新しい属性 (2)
はじめに: input 要素と textarea 要素にはユーザー用の新しい要素 dirname が追加されました。方向制御 (翻訳、つまり書き込み方向、ltr または rtl)。
はじめに: HTML5 は、入力された型 type にさまざまな列挙値を追加して、形式が間違っている場合に検証する機能もあります。提供されているオリジナルのエラー プロンプトは非常に素晴らしく、詳細は次のとおりです:
8. HTML5 学習メモの簡潔版 (4): meter、datalist、keygen、output の新しい要素
はじめに:
9. HTML5学習メモの簡潔版(3):新しい要素hgroup、ヘッダー、フッター
はじめに:HTML5学習メモの簡潔版(3):新しい要素hgroup、ヘッダー、フッター、アドレス、ナビゲーション
10. HTML5 学習ノートの簡潔なバージョン (2): 新しい要素セクション、記事、余談
はじめに: セクション要素はドキュメントまたは通常のセクション プログラム内のセクション 一般に、セクションにはヘッドとコンテンツのコンテンツ ブロックが含まれます。セクションは、セクション、またはタブ ページのタブの下にあるボックス ブロックとして表すことができます。ページは、紹介、ニュース項目、連絡先情報をそれぞれ表す複数のセクションに分割できます。
【関連Q&Aのおすすめ】:
以上がコア アーキテクチャ設計の簡潔なバージョンに関する簡単な説明の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

HTMLの将来の傾向はセマンティクスとWebコンポーネントであり、CSSの将来の傾向はCSS-in-JSとCSShoudiniであり、JavaScriptの将来の傾向はWebAssemblyとServerLessです。 1。HTMLセマンティクスはアクセシビリティとSEO効果を改善し、Webコンポーネントは開発効率を向上させますが、ブラウザの互換性に注意を払う必要があります。 2。CSS-in-JSは、スタイル管理の柔軟性を高めますが、ファイルサイズを増やす可能性があります。 CSShoudiniは、CSSレンダリングの直接操作を可能にします。 3. Webassemblyブラウザーアプリケーションのパフォーマンスを最適化しますが、急な学習曲線があり、サーバーレスは開発を簡素化しますが、コールドスタートの問題の最適化が必要です。

Web開発におけるHTML、CSS、およびJavaScriptの役割は次のとおりです。1。HTMLは、Webページ構造を定義し、2。CSSはWebページスタイルを制御し、3。JavaScriptは動的な動作を追加します。一緒に、彼らは最新のウェブサイトのフレームワーク、美学、および相互作用を構築します。

HTMLの将来は、無限の可能性に満ちています。 1)新機能と標準には、より多くのセマンティックタグとWebComponentsの人気が含まれます。 2)Webデザインのトレンドは、レスポンシブでアクセス可能なデザインに向けて発展し続けます。 3)パフォーマンスの最適化により、応答性の高い画像読み込みと怠zyなロードテクノロジーを通じてユーザーエクスペリエンスが向上します。

Web開発におけるHTML、CSS、およびJavaScriptの役割は次のとおりです。HTMLはコンテンツ構造を担当し、CSSはスタイルを担当し、JavaScriptは動的な動作を担当します。 1。HTMLは、セマンティクスを確保するためにタグを使用してWebページの構造とコンテンツを定義します。 2。CSSは、セレクターと属性を介してWebページスタイルを制御して、美しく読みやすくします。 3。JavaScriptは、動的でインタラクティブな関数を実現するために、スクリプトを通じてWebページの動作を制御します。

htmlisnotaprogramminglanguage; itisamarkuplanguage.1)htmlStructuresandformatswebcontentusingtags.2)ItworkswithcsssssssssdjavascriptforInteractivity、強化を促進します。

HTMLは、Webページ構造の構築の基礎です。 1。HTMLは、コンテンツ構造とセマンティクス、および使用などを定義します。タグ。 2. SEO効果を改善するために、などのセマンティックマーカーを提供します。 3.タグを介したユーザーの相互作用を実現するには、フォーム検証に注意してください。 4. JavaScriptと組み合わせて、動的効果を実現するなどの高度な要素を使用します。 5.一般的なエラーには、閉じられていないラベルと引用されていない属性値が含まれ、検証ツールが必要です。 6.最適化戦略には、HTTP要求の削減、HTMLの圧縮、セマンティックタグの使用などが含まれます。

HTMLは、Webページを構築するために使用される言語であり、タグと属性を使用してWebページの構造とコンテンツを定義します。 1)htmlは、などのタグを介してドキュメント構造を整理します。 2)ブラウザはHTMLを分析してDOMを構築し、Webページをレンダリングします。 3)マルチメディア関数を強化するなど、HTML5の新機能。 4)一般的なエラーには、閉じられていないラベルと引用されていない属性値が含まれます。 5)最適化の提案には、セマンティックタグの使用とファイルサイズの削減が含まれます。

webdevelopmentReliesOnhtml、css、andjavascript:1)htmlStructuresContent、2)cssStylesit、および3)Javascriptaddsinteractivity、形成、


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

Dreamweaver Mac版
ビジュアル Web 開発ツール

メモ帳++7.3.1
使いやすく無料のコードエディター

mPDF
mPDF は、UTF-8 でエンコードされた HTML から PDF ファイルを生成できる PHP ライブラリです。オリジナルの作者である Ian Back は、Web サイトから「オンザフライ」で PDF ファイルを出力し、さまざまな言語を処理するために mPDF を作成しました。 HTML2FPDF などのオリジナルのスクリプトよりも遅く、Unicode フォントを使用すると生成されるファイルが大きくなりますが、CSS スタイルなどをサポートし、多くの機能強化が施されています。 RTL (アラビア語とヘブライ語) や CJK (中国語、日本語、韓国語) を含むほぼすべての言語をサポートします。ネストされたブロックレベル要素 (P、DIV など) をサポートします。

Safe Exam Browser
Safe Exam Browser は、オンライン試験を安全に受験するための安全なブラウザ環境です。このソフトウェアは、あらゆるコンピュータを安全なワークステーションに変えます。あらゆるユーティリティへのアクセスを制御し、学生が無許可のリソースを使用するのを防ぎます。

SAP NetWeaver Server Adapter for Eclipse
Eclipse を SAP NetWeaver アプリケーション サーバーと統合します。
